Sr. Scientific Applications Manager

Full Time US

Cytek Biosciences is seeking a highly experienced and customer-focused Senior Applications Manager to lead advanced workflow adoption across complex laboratory environments. This role will serve as a key scientific and operational partner to customers and internal stakeholders, owning successful implementation, workflow optimization, user adoption, and long‑term customer success for Cytek’s advanced cell analysis solutions portfolio.

The ideal candidate combines deep technical expertise in flow cytometry workflows with strong leadership, communication, and cross‑functional influence. This individual will work closely with Sales, Field Applications, Service, Product Management, Marketing, and customer laboratory teams to drive successful deployment and operational integration of Cytek technologies within sophisticated research and regulated laboratory environments.

This role requires strong scientific credibility, strategic thinking, and the ability to shape outcomes across complex operational workflows across diverse customer settings.
